Road safety is a top priority for commercial fleets, logistics companies, and public transportation providers. Every year, thousands of accidents and near-misses occur due to poor visibility, driver fatigue, and blind spots. While driver training and regulations are essential, technology plays an increasingly critical role in improving safety.

High-definition (HD) vehicle cameras, integrated with Mobile DVR (MDVR) systems, offer a proactive solution. They enhance driver awareness, reduce accidents, and provide critical evidence when incidents occur. This article explores how HD cameras improve road safety, their features, and their practical benefits for fleet operators.



1. Clearer Vision in All Conditions


HD cameras capture high-resolution footage, enabling drivers and fleet managers to see critical details that standard cameras might miss. This includes:

  • Road signs and lane markings

  • Pedestrians and cyclists

  • Oncoming vehicles and obstacles


Night Vision Capability:
Many HD cameras feature infrared or low-light sensors, allowing:

  • Clear visibility during nighttime operations

  • Safer urban and rural driving

  • Reduced risk of collisions in poorly lit areas


Example:
A bus fleet operating early morning and late evening routes found that HD cameras significantly improved driver reaction times, particularly in low-light conditions. Incidents of minor collisions decreased by 20% within three months.



2. Reducing Blind Spots and Enhancing Situational Awareness


Even experienced drivers have blind spots, particularly in large vehicles such as trucks and buses. Multi-angle HD cameras help reduce blind spots by providing:

  • Front, rear, and side coverage

  • Cargo area monitoring

  • Interior cabin views for driver behavior supervision


Practical Insight:
A logistics company equipped all delivery trucks with 8-channel HD cameras. Drivers reported improved confidence when reversing or navigating narrow streets, resulting in fewer minor accidents and vehicle damage.



3. Driver Behavior Monitoring and Training


HD cameras capture driver actions and habits, allowing fleet managers to:

  • Identify unsafe behaviors like harsh braking, sudden lane changes, or distracted driving

  • Provide targeted training based on real footage

  • Encourage compliance with safety protocols


Case Study:
A regional bus operator used HD footage to analyze driver performance. By providing personalized coaching based on real driving behavior, the company saw a 25% reduction in unsafe driving incidents over six months.



4. Accident Evidence and Liability Protection


In the unfortunate event of a collision, HD vehicle cameras provide:

  • Detailed evidence for insurance claims

  • Accurate timelines and event reconstruction

  • Protection against false liability claims


Example:
A delivery truck was involved in a collision with a passenger vehicle. Thanks to HD footage, it was immediately clear that the other driver ran a red light. The insurance claim was processed quickly, avoiding unnecessary legal costs.


Insight:
High-definition video is especially important in urban areas with heavy traffic and complex intersections, where accurate footage can make all the difference in liability determination.



5. Integration With Advanced Driver Assistance Systems (ADAS)


Many HD cameras now integrate with ADAS to enhance real-time driver alerts:

  • Lane departure warnings

  • Collision avoidance alerts

  • Pedestrian detection

  • Speed monitoring


Practical Example:
A truck fleet integrated HD cameras with ADAS features. When approaching sharp curves or congested intersections, drivers received alerts, reducing near-miss incidents by 30%.



6. Fleet-Wide Monitoring and Operational Efficiency


HD cameras, when paired with MDVRs, allow fleet managers to monitor vehicles remotely. Benefits include:

  • Centralized monitoring of multiple vehicles

  • Real-time alerts for unsafe driving or route deviations

  • Ability to intervene before incidents escalate


Case Study:
A nationwide logistics company used HD cameras and MDVRs to oversee long-haul routes. By identifying unsafe practices early, they improved fleet-wide safety metrics and reduced incident response times by 40%.



7. Enhancing Night and Low-Light Driving Safety


Accidents often occur in low-light conditions, during early morning, evening, or poor weather. HD cameras with infrared or low-light capabilities provide:

  • Clear footage even in near-darkness

  • Enhanced visibility for drivers on poorly lit roads

  • Evidence for incident review if accidents occur


Practical Insight:
Fleet operators in rural areas reported that HD cameras dramatically improved night driving confidence, especially on winding or unlit roads.



8. Supporting Cargo and Passenger Safety


HD cameras also protect cargo and passengers by monitoring:

  • Unauthorized access or tampering

  • Unsafe passenger behavior on buses

  • Proper handling of goods in transit


Example:
A refrigerated logistics fleet used interior and cargo HD cameras. Managers could verify that goods were handled properly and detect any tampering during stops, preventing potential losses.



9. Data-Driven Safety Improvements


By analyzing HD footage over time, companies can:

  • Identify recurring accident hotspots

  • Improve route planning to avoid dangerous areas

  • Adjust fleet policies based on observed risks


Practical Application:
A delivery company reviewed six months of HD footage and identified that most minor collisions occurred during tight urban turns. By adjusting routes and providing targeted driver training, collisions decreased by 15%.
